This is known as the formal charge. The formula for formal charge: Let us find out for CO32- : For Carbon, formal charge= 4 - 0.5*8 - 0 = 4 - 4 = 0. For each of the O in a single bond with carbon, formal charge = 6 - 0.5*2 - 6 = 6 - 1 - 6 = -1. Together, they comprise a single ion with a 1+ charge and a formula of NH 4 +. The carbonate ion (see figure below) consists of one carbon atom and three oxygen atoms and carries an overall charge of 2−. The formula of the carbonate ion is CO 3 2 −. wild birds unlimited sudburypollen count springfield ma SO2 Molecular Geometry. The SO2 molecular geometry is bent, with a bond angle of 120°. They were used on the longest and highest-altitude unmanned solar-powered aeroplane flight (at the time) by Zephyr 6 in ... where to find uscis online account numberqpublic fanninpeachpass login The oxidation state of a simple ion like hydride is equal to the charge on the ion—in this case, -1. Alternatively, the sum of the oxidation states in a neutral compound is zero. Because Group 1 metals always have an oxidation state of +1 in their compounds, it follows that the hydrogen must have an oxidation state of -1 (+1 -1 = 0).Description.
